Technical Specifications and Key Features
The Suunto M4 Fitness Watch Heart Rate Monitor combines essential fitness tracking with a user-friendly interface designed for clarity and ease of use. The device features a large display and operates with just three buttons, making it accessible for users of all skill levels, with support for nine different languages . It includes a built-in physical fitness test that requires a brisk 1km (or 1.6km) walk to establish a baseline for your custom fitness plan .
Key features and performance metrics include:
- Personalized Training Program: Automatically adapts your training schedule for the next seven days based on your fitness test results .
- Real-Time Workout Guidance: Provides instructions during exercise to optimize intensity and duration .
- Heart Rate Monitoring: Tracks heart rate zones, calories burned, and exercise duration in real-time .
- Exercise Summaries: Delivers detailed post-workout feedback including average heart rate and total kcal consumption .
- Connectivity: Optional Suunto Movestick allows wireless data transfer to Movescount.com for long-term tracking .
- Compatibility: The included heart rate belt works with most gym cardio equipment and Suunto Fitness Solution systems .

Troubleshooting Common Issues and Solutions
Users of the Suunto M4 Fitness Watch Heart Rate Monitor may encounter occasional connectivity or signal issues. Below are common problems and their solutions to ensure optimal performance.
Heart Rate Signal Not Detected: If the watch fails to detect your heart rate, first ensure the heart rate belt contact zones are properly humidified before wearing . The belt must be snug against the skin, and the transmitter module should be fully inserted . If the signal is intermittent, check that the battery in the transmitter (typically CR2025) is not depleted .
Physical Fitness Test Errors: If the fitness test fails or stops prematurely, ensure you are walking at a constant, brisk pace for the full 1.6 km (1 mile) distance . Stopping or varying your speed significantly can cause the test to abort .
Data Transfer Issues: If workout data does not sync to Movescount.com, verify that the optional Suunto Movestick is correctly connected and that your computer has the necessary drivers installed .
Preventive Measures: Rinse the chest strap after each use and machine wash it (without the smart module) at 30°C every 2–3 uses to maintain sensor contact . Avoid using fabric softeners .
